Copyright © 2026 toronto.yabsta.com All Right Reserved
powered by
465 Parliament St. Scarborough, ON, Canada, M5A 3A3
100 Sunrise Ave., Unit 134 Scarborough, ON, Canada, M4A 1B3
23 Redhill Ave. Scarborough, ON, Canada, M6E 2C2
33 Brydon Drv. Scarborough, ON, Canada, M9W 4N3
21 Musgrave St. Scarborough, ON, Canada, M4E 2H3
2477 Bloor West Scarborough, ON, Canada, M6S 1P7
3915 Keele St. Scarborough, ON, Canada, M3J 1N6
1588 Dupont St. Scarborough, ON, Canada, M6P 3S6
185 The West Mall #600 Etobicoke, ON, Canada, M9C 5L5
170 Finchdene Sq. #10 Scarborough, ON, Canada, M1X 1B2